The 2022 World Cup is the Most Expensive FIFA Tournament in History.
The costs incurred are almost 20 times the funds spent by Russia to host the 2018 World Cup.
But economically, the World Cup is also predicted to provide many advantages for Qatar.
Estimated that during the world cup, will be around 1.2 million visitors come and watch live at the stadium.
And will add revenue for the Qatar economy to $17 billion.

It's always a bit of a gamble for the hosting country, sometimes they spend way too much preparing and building stadiums, etc, and then the money they collected is just not enough to cover those costs.
An interesting point is that in Qatar there's a ban on alcohol, which is one of the areas in which hosts make the most money from.
